Fees
2026 rate for Full Members
US$2,000 per ship + US$0.01 per dwt (all vessels independent of type)
The yearly fee is based on the fleet as at 1 January. Any acquisitions or sales during a year do not trigger any additional invoices nor credit notes. Changes are reflected the following year.
How to calculate your rate
(US$2,000 x number of tankers) + (US$0.01 x total dwt) = annual fee
Example
The Annual Membership Fee for a fleet of six tankers with a total dwt of 397,433 for 2025 is calculated as follows:
(US$2,000 x 6) + (US$0.01 x 397,433) = US$12,000 + US$3,974 = US$15,974
Fleet definition
The fleet is defined as all tank vessels which the Member owns and/or manages, including tank vessels of affiliated and associated companies.
Minimum and maximum fees
The minimum fee for 2026 is US$6,050
The maximum fee for 2026 is US$90,000
2026 rates for Associate Members
2026 rates for Associate Members remain unchanged.
- US$2,860 per year for eligible companies/organisations in the following sectors: Bunker Brokers/Test Labs; Consultants; Environmental Organisations; Flag Administrations; Financial Institutions/Banks; Insurers; Legal Firms; Marine Suppliers & Services; Naval Architects; Port Authorities; Public Relations Companies; Reception Facilities; Ship Recycling Facilities; Ship Agents; Commercial Ship Managers and Shipowners without Tankers.
- US$5,170 per year for eligible companies/organisations in the following sectors: Classification Societies; P&I Clubs; Shipbrokers; Shipyards; and State or Energy Company-Owned Tanker Owners/ Managers.
- US$6,050 per year for eligible companies/organisations in the following sectors: Energy Companies; Traders & Charterers.
